The Locked On NBA Game Night podcast delivers a comprehensive postgame breakdown of the final NBA games of the 2025-26 season, highlighting the stark contrast between playoff contenders and teams actively tanking. The episode opens with a dramatic 147-101 blowout by the Utah Jazz over the Memphis Grizzlies, a game so devoid of competitive effort that it became a symbol of the league's tanking culture, with Memphis playing just six players and sitting their starters for much of the third quarter. Meanwhile, the Portland Trail Blazers secured the 8th seed with a win over the Clippers, setting up a potential play-in matchup with the Kings. On the playoff side, the New York Knicks clinched the 3rd seed with a dominant win over the Raptors, while the Hawks returned to the playoffs for the first time since 2023, and the Lakers remained in contention for the 3rd seed in the West. Victor Wembanyama made a stunning return from injury, scoring 40 points in just 26 minutes to lead the Spurs to a 139-120 victory over the Mavericks, solidifying his MVP candidacy and making him eligible for postseason awards. The episode also covers the emotional highs and lows of the season’s final stretch, including the Sixers keeping slim playoff hopes alive and the Warriors’ continued struggles despite Steph Curry’s return. The hosts reflect on the season’s narrative arc: a league divided between teams fighting for legacy and those prioritizing draft position, with the future of the NBA’s tanking problem hanging in the balance.
